Carlisle - a nice place to live
Star Rating - 1/2/2015
Carlisle, PA, is at a crossroads of interstate 81 and US 76 (turnpike) which means its easy to get to, and easy to get out to places from. The town of Carlisle itself hosts Dickinson College, and The US Army War College, a huge Amazon distribution center, Carlisle Events (enormous car shows), and a lively downtown. The local schools are solid, and there's quite a bit of recreational events nearby - Hershey, hiking, hunting, trout fishing, theatre, and local athletic clubs.
